// Copyright (c) Microsoft Corporation. All rights reserved.
// Licensed under the MIT License.
#include "onnxruntime_pybind.h" // must use this for the include of <pybind11/pybind11.h>
#include <pybind11/stl.h>
#include "core/providers/get_execution_providers.h"
#include "onnxruntime_config.h"
namespace onnxruntime {
namespace python {
namespace py = pybind11;
void CreateInferencePybindStateModule(py::module& m);
PYBIND11_MODULE(onnxruntime_pybind11_state, m) {
CreateInferencePybindStateModule(m);
// move it out of shared method since training build has a little different behavior.
m.def(
"get_available_providers", []() -> const std::vector<std::string>& { return GetAvailableExecutionProviderNames(); },
"Return list of available Execution Providers in this installed version of Onnxruntime. "
"The order of elements represents the default priority order of Execution Providers "
"from highest to lowest.");
m.def("get_version_string", []() -> std::string { return ORT_VERSION; });
m.def("get_build_info", []() -> std::string { return ORT_BUILD_INFO; });
}
} // namespace python
} // namespace onnxruntime
